The Nextcure lawsuit was filed on behalf of investors who purchased Nextcure, Inc. (NASDAQ: NXTC) securities: (1) between November 5, 2019 and July 14, 2020, inclusive; and/or (2) pursuant or traceable to the company's secondary public offering declared effective on November 14, 2019.

Throughout the class period defendants' statements were materially misleading because the data Defendants possessed on its principle product candidate, NC318, showed a lack of efficacy and objective responses. Had the truth been revealed, the market would have seen that NC318 was not, in fact, effective in treating most tumor types, that the NC318 application was proving to be limited (if even useful at all), and, as a result, there was a significant realizable risk that NC318 would not be nearly as popular as then-existing blockbuster drugs, such as Keytruda.

The GoHealth lawsuit is on behalf of all purchasers of GoHealth Class A common stock pursuant and/or traceable to the registration statement issued in connection with GoHealth's July 2020 initial public offering.

Allegations against GOCO include that: (i) the Medicare insurance industry was undergoing a period of elevated churn, which had begun in the first half of 2020; (ii) GoHealth suffered from a higher risk of customer churn as a result of its unique business model and limited carrier base; (iii) GoHealth suffered from degradations in customer persistency and retention as a result of elevated industry churn, vulnerabilities that arose from the Company's concentrated carrier business model, and GoHealth's efforts to expand into new geographies, develop new carrier partnerships and worsening product mix; (iv) GoHealth had entered into materially less favorable revenue sharing arrangements with its external sales agents; and (v) these adverse financial and operational trends were internally projected by GoHealth to continue and worsen following the initial public offering.

Class Period: April 16, 2019 - October 1, 2020

Allegations against MESO include that: (1) comparative analyses between Mesoblast's Phase 3 trial and three historical studies did not support the effectiveness of the Company's lead product candidate, remestemcel-L, for steroid refractory acute graft versus host disease due to design differences between the four studies; (2) as a result, the US Food and Drug Administration was reasonably likely to require further clinical studies; (3) as a result, the commercialization of remestemcel-L in the U.S. was likely to be delayed; and (4) as a result of the foregoing, Defendants' positive statements about the Company's business, operations, and prospects were materially misleading and/or lacked a reasonable basis.
